What Causes Low Water Pressure in the Kitchen Faucet?

Getting low water pressure from your spout can be very annoying. Appropriate water pressure is a must-have in the kitchen. Otherwise, no matter how much water you use, it may not affect productivity.

But why does this sudden pressure decrease in many faucets happen? I have explained below some of the major reasons for this problem. Find them out below:

1. Dirty And Blocked Aerators

In spouts, the aerator is a mesh disc-like object that sits at the opening of every spout to keep the flow of water at a moderate amount. It mixes water with air to make it softer and filter it from pollutants.

One of the top reasons faucets get low-pressure water is their aerators get dirty over time. They accumulate a lot of mineral debris, sediments, and other impurities from the main line water.

These sediments block the pathway of water flowing out. And as a result, less water flows out, and it also has low pressure.

2. Leaking Faucet

A leak in the water line may also cause your faucet pressure to drop. The leak often happens under the kitchen cabinet or the faucet itself. You may also have a leak in your main water line.

In that case, water constantly drips through the leaking part and drops pressure near the spout. If the leak is too big, the amount of water you receive through your spout may also drastically decrease.

3. Impurities Are Clogging Your Main Line

Your water pressure could decrease due to any connecting pipes in your main water line getting blocked. This is natural as a larger impurity can get into our water tank.

They then come through the pipes and get stuck, causing the force of water to drop drastically. As a result, the pressure also decreases.

4. The Shut-off Valves Are In The Wrong Setting

Shut-off valves are like the main switch to your faucet. These valves can completely turn on or off an individual faucet’s water supply and are generally located underneath the kitchen sink. 

Another thing the shut-off valves do is control the water pressure in your spout. 

They’re like a regulator that you can rotate to regulate the pressure. Hence, sometimes, you may mistakenly end up rotating the valve to the wrong setting. This can also cause a pressure drop.

Clean Aerators

To increase the pressure of your spout again, you need to clean this small piece of tool.

Cleaning it is an easy procedure. 

  • Take a plier or use your hands to untighten the aerator. It works like a screw, so rotating it with a bit of force will do the work. 
  • Next, check the amount of dirt accumulated on the mesh’s back side. If it’s a lot of sediments, you now know what was the cause behind the low pressure. 
  • So, flip the aerator and run some water through the opposite side of the mesh so the loosened dirt can flow away.
  • After that, take some white vinegar in a cup and dip the aerator inside for an hour. The vinegar will clear up all the other impurities. 
  • Finish off by brushing with a toothbrush to clean everything up.
  • You will notice the water pressure is much better now. If you want to clean the faucet aerator without removing it, you can also do that by taking the vinegar in a bag.

Check the Shut-off Valves

If the shut-off valves have become loose, you may lose pressure in the faucets. Having it in a midway setting can decrease the pressure to a low enough degree. In such a case, you have to tighten your valves again to revive the pressure.

Rotate the valve fully to the highest setting, and you will notice a difference in the water force. 

Clean Any Clogs In the Pipe or Tank

As you may already know, your water tank may have large impurities that can block the water pipes. In that case, you have to first figure out where the clog is situated. You can do it by checking the pressure in all the faucets of the house.

If they all get low pressure, the problem is coming from the pipes outside the house. To remove or clean the lines, you can call the municipality or a local plumber.

They know very well how to fix these problems and reach that part of the line. So, there is nothing to worry about. Get them to clean the tank as well, as it can gather dirt over time.

Resolve Any Leaks

If you find a leak in the faucet, you need to fix the leaking part immediately to not waste any water. If the leak is someplace else within the main line, look for wet or moist spots and immediately contact a plumber. 

Whether to replace or repair the leaky faucet remains a confusion. This depends on the extent of the damage. If your plumber says the repair wouldn’t cost much, you should go for it.

However, if the leak is unrepairable or would cost as much as purchasing a new faucet, you should opt for a replacement instead.

Turn off All the Other Faucets

Another reason your water pressure may often decrease is that the main water supply line supplies water to multiple other faucets simultaneously. 

The water traveling in so many directions reduces its amount, resulting in a decrease in the pressure.

So, if no other solution works, a way to increase the water pressure is by turning off all the other faucets/showers/hoses and only running the one in the kitchen. You will instantly notice the difference in the pressure.

The kitchen spout will then flow water with more strength, and you can comfortably do your washing.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How much psi pressure should a home faucet have?

The ideal pressure in home spouts should be 40 to 60 psi. You can measure this by getting a water pressure gauge. If the pressure is under 40 psi, you need to get some fixes done.

2. Which type of leak in the faucet is repairable?

If it’s a leak in the cartridge, it’s possible to repair it. But if the leak is due to body damage in the faucet, you will need to replace it.

3. What is the debris that blocked my aerator and reduced pressure?

The water that we receive has a lot of minerals in them. Over time, as aerators pass water so much, they have buildups of these minerals. These then block the mesh holes. Other dirt and pollutants may also clog the aerators.

4. Can I increase my water pressure by replacing the faucet?

You cannot be sure that the problem lies in your faucet. It can be in any other part of your waterline as well. So be sure that the tap is at fault before replacing it.
